TBC, with the CAS number 52434-90-9, is a brominated flame retardant. Brominated flame retardants (BFRs) are a class of chemical compounds containing bromine that, when added to combustible materials, delay or prevent the spread of fire. TBC stands out due to its molecular structure, which incorporates six bromine atoms, providing a high level of flame retardancy. As a white powder, it exhibits a melting point typically between 105-115°C, making it manageable in various processing conditions.

One of the primary advantages of TBC is its effectiveness across a wide array of polymers. This includes polyolefins (such as PE and PP), PVC, polystyrene (PS), foaming polyurethane, polycarbonate, ABS, unsaturated polyesters, poly methyl methacrylate, polyester, and various synthetic rubbers and fibers. For manufacturers working with these materials, integrating TBC can significantly enhance the fire safety profile of their final products, making them suitable for applications with stringent fire regulations. The applications of TBC are diverse and impactful. In the textile industry, it is used to impart flame retardancy to fabrics for upholstery, curtains, and protective clothing, crucial for public safety and compliance with standards. For plastics manufacturers, TBC is incorporated into materials used in electronics, automotive components, and building and construction, where fire risk mitigation is essential. It also finds application in rubber conveyor belts and foam insulation, contributing to safer industrial environments. Beyond its fire retardant capabilities, TBC boasts several desirable characteristics. It exhibits low volatility, meaning it does not easily evaporate during processing or use, thus maintaining its efficacy over time. Its good compatibility with various polymer matrices ensures that it can be effectively dispersed without negatively impacting the physical properties of the base material. Furthermore, TBC is known for its durability, lightfastness, and water resistance, ensuring the flame-retardant properties are maintained even under challenging environmental conditions.
